...I wanted to introduce you to some of my favourite restaurants in the area. One of them is Ariana in Mile End, a little gem that I discovered way too late after living nearby for six years. It’s situated near Mile End Park and is easily within walking distance from the tube station. It serves Iranian and Afghan food. The exterior is unimpressive, in fact I am convinced the neon sign above the door actually deterred me from visiting it earlier, but the interior is nicer. But once you step inside you have to be taken back into a different world. The first object that grabbed my attention is a stone oven, where the waiters will bake your homemade tandori bread. Chelow KebabEKubedeh: 8.50 | Just a quick note, I'm unsure about the price. I think it was 8.50 but a little hazy. Anyway on with my thoughts. When I went there, it was empty as they had just opened the restaurant. First thing you notice is the beautiful decor. I absolutely loved it! Also as stated in many reviews, you get to watch fresh bread being made in what seemed to me a tandoor. All the waiters were friendly and welcoming too. So after I sat down, I was given the menu and the meal I got stood out to me the most. The meal consisted of two skewers of charcoal grilled lamb served with saffron steamed basmati rice and grilled tomato and salad. Presentation wise, it was great....read more

baked aubergines with tomatoes and egg GBP 4.50 – I think the aubergines were slightly burnt rather than charcoaled. But otherwise, was a nice warm dip with the bread.houmous GBP 3.95 – good texture with little chuncky bits but lacks seasoning and the punch of garlic.bread GBP 1.50 – eat while it is warm because it gets crispy when it is cooled.mantoo GBP 8.95 – wheat flour stuffed with minced lamb and onions, served with yoghurt, dry mint and meat sauce. The pasta was light and not cloying on the teeth. Stuffed with generous filling of meat and sauce, it was my favourite.portions of marinated whole poussin, charcoal grilled, served with saffron steamed basmati rice and...read more
